Costa Rica names new tourism minister

Costa Rica has appointed Mauricio Ventura Aragon as new tourism minister.

Ventura Aragon will lead the development of Costa Rica Tourism Board marketing in international markets and brings a wealth of tourism marketing experience.

He was president of the National Tourism Chamber (CANATUR) in the 1990s and is a current member of the San Jose Tourism Board.

Welcoming the new appointment, Alberto Lopez, general manager of Costa Rica Tourism Board said: "We are pleased to welcome Mauricio Ventura Aragón as the new minister of tourism. His extensive experience in the hospitality industry and passion for Costa Rica will foster growth and innovation, which will assist Costa Rica in achieving its goal of positioning itself as the top-of-mind destination for all travelers."

Ventura Aragon takes over from Wilhelm von Breymann who resigned as tourism minister last month.
